Tiny Champions should be in everyone's rotation of go to restaurants. Not too fancy and stuffy while still being inventive and putting out food that is nuanced. We always pick two familiar dishes and get two new ones whenever we go out there. This time it was the Greens Pizza (the fanciest Cici's spinach pizza) and the braised butter beans for the familiar dishes. One note is reading braised butter beans on a menu may not sound the most appealing but it is consistently the most flavorful dish you will have there. The beans are really savory/creamy and there are crunchy croutons for a textural contrast. They also get some acid in there for a really good balanced bite. The new dishes this go around were the fried quail and the baked feta. The fried quail tasted like some of the best Korean fried chicken you could have. My only issue with that dish is that I need way more of it, like a whole bucket of it with a gallon of their fancy ranch. The baked feta was good, but not something I'd order again. Just not as flavorful as everything else.

Everything here is delicious and the service always outstanding. The pizzas are packed with flavor, good for sharing, not flimsy and greasy, and you can add different toppings/dipping sauces (get the "fancy" ranch). Appetizers...I could stuff my face on the apps alone, especially the fried scamorza cheese. Pastas are simple but great, also shareable sizes for the table. Great variety of cocktails, wine, and nonalcoholic beverages. The restaurant itself is cozy and has a homey feeling with some really nice decor to make it a great spot for a night out with friends, anniversary, or just enjoying a leisurely Sunday afternoon. Make a reservation on the weekends! Don't forget to leave room for dessert...the menu changes every so often but it's so creative and delicious that you can't go wrong with any of the desserts. This is without a doubt my top 3 favorite restaurants in Houston!

I came here on a Thursday night for a drink at the bar and a birthday dinner. Parking on the street was plentiful and felt somewhat safe, despite the fresh broken glass on a spot I decided to pass up, for one in front of main entrance. Once inside you feel transported into a cozy atmosphere with friendly bartenders. Of all the drinks I opted for the Evil eye that had the right amount of pomegranate, lime juice and liquor 43. That's right, the same herbal spirit in your Nespresso carajillos. Perfectly shaken and at $11 or so, I could see myself ubering back for a few very soon. Onto the dinner, there were about 12 in our party and we were seated in a long rectangular formation. No split checks so let's order some big ass plates for all. Of all the pizzas, I enjoyed the pepperoni the best. With a tasty pepperoni profile and perfectly chewy crust, this pizza is a must order. There was a ravioli with green peas that I absolutely enjoyed and would order again. The dessert was divine and that coffee ice cream and fudge combo be bussin'! The service was impeccable and the only reason I must take a 1 star deduction are the prices. Perhaps our group ordered the high dollar dishes; but I think the overall price for the table should have reflected more of a caviar priced dinner. But a solid spot for cocktails and attentive service.

Solid Houston Happy Hour spot! My friends and I made a last-minute reservation - thank God we did because it got busy. We ordered some items on and off the HH menu. What's nice is that they have an extensive mocktail list - try the ricotta dreamsicle! For food we shared their oysters, Greens Pizza, Braised Butter Beans, Mushrooms, Baked Feta, Rigatoni, and Pistachio Lemon Ricotta Ice Cream Cake. Everything was amazing and nicely portioned, and my top 2 faves were the Baked Feta and the Ice Cream Cake. The baked feta was so creamy and comforting, while the Ice Cream Cake wasn't overly sweet and so refreshing with the fresh slices of orange on top. I had their Coko Loko cocktail which packed a punch and ended with a lovely pandan coconut note. Lastly our server was very attentive. Would definitely come back! Side note: there's tons of free street parking right outside the restaurant
